Abstract
In an example, a system for distributed video creation is provided. In an example, the system enables users to create the ideas that they and others might film and/or upload. These may be single scene ideas, or multiple scene ideas. These ideas may be as part of a broader, existing video work, or a new video work. These ideas may be manifested as text (such as descriptions or instructions) or verbal (audio), or through pictures or video.
Claims
exact text as granted — not AI-modified1 . A memory device having instructions stored thereon that, in response to execution by a processing device, cause the processing device to perform operations comprising:
storing in a database on a network a plurality of profiles each corresponding to a respective member of a distributed video service; receiving a description of a scene from a particular one of the members; identifying a subset of the other members; causing user terminals associated with only the identified subset of members to display the scene description; assigning each video of a plurality of member-provided videos with a different take identifier; providing information associated with the member-provided videos to a user terminal associated with the particular one of the members, wherein the provided information includes at least the take identifiers; receiving a selection from the user terminal associated with the particular one of the members, wherein the received selection includes a take identifier of the plurality of take identifiers; and combining the member-provided video associated with the take identifier of the received selection with another one of the member-provided videos.
